Technical Description & Manual Scope

Machine: Liebherr LGD 1550 Mobile Crane (Lattice Boom) Serial Number: 073713 Publication Number: BAL-No. 04919-02-02 Format: PDF (791 Pages)

OEM Operational Documentation Overview

This master operating manual provides definitive technical guidance for the Liebherr LGD 1550, a high-capacity lattice boom mobile crane. Unlike standard telescopic manuals, this document details the complex modularity of the lattice system, covering the integration of heavy-lift derrick attachments with an all-terrain chassis. It serves as the primary reference for configuration planning, assembly/disassembly procedures, and systems diagnostics.

1. Boom Configuration & Attachment Systems

The manual offers granular detail on the LGD 1550’s modular boom systems, including assembly protocols and rigging schematics for:

  • SL-System: Heavy-lift main boom configurations.
  • SW-System: Luffing fly jib combinations for extended reach and “up-and-over” capabilities.
  • Derrick (D) System: Superlift/Derrick counterweight attachments (floating and tray ballast) for max load moment enhancement.
  • Hybrid Configurations: Comprehensive setup data for specialized modes including SDWB (Suspended Derrick / Luffing Jib), SDB, SLN, and SDBWN.
  • Component Rigging: Detailed instructions for the 100t boom nose, A-bracket erection, and sliding arm installation.

2. Operational Logistics & Load Charts

Critical engineering data for lift planning and on-site stability:

  • Raising & Lowering Charts: Specific kinetic limits for erecting long boom combinations to prevent structural failure during setup.
  • Reeving Plans: Complete rope reeving diagrams for various hook blocks and hoist configurations, ensuring correct line pull distribution.
  • Ballast Logistics: Assembly/disassembly sequences for base plates and counterweight slabs, including stacking logic for various load curves.

3. Chassis & Powertrain Logic

Technical operation of the carrier unit:

  • Axle & Suspension: Operation of the hydropneumatic suspension, including level control and specific axle locking protocols for static stability.
  • Steering & Braking: Pneumatic brake system inspection, retarder operation, and multi-mode steering configurations for tight job site maneuvering.
  • Drive Train: Gearbox management and differential lock engagement strategies for off-road terrain.

4. LICCON Computer System & Diagnostics

A dedicated section covers the Liebherr Computed Control (LICCON) system, the brain of the crane:

  • LMI Setup: Programming the Load Moment Indicator for specific boom codes and counterweight charts.
  • Error Localization: Diagnostic codes and troubleshooting flowcharts to isolate electrical or sensor faults within the safety system.
  • Safety Cut-offs: Parameters for hoist limit switches, wind speed monitoring, and ground pressure sensors.

5. Maintenance & Service Standards

Factory-mandated intervals and procedures to maintain operational certification:

  • Lubrication Schedules: Complete charts for greasing boom pivot points, slew rings, and wire ropes.
  • Wire Rope Inspection: ISO-standard “Discard Criteria” for hoisting and luffing ropes.
  • Hydraulics & Pneumatics: Pressure monitoring for accumulator cylinders and tension columns.
